Originally Posted by korndawg
Ordered the 1" forward mounts, headers, and just recieved the 302-2 oil pan. To get this straight, you must use the Holley crossmember for the 4L80e?
I wouldn't say you "have" to use the Hooker crossmember, but you'll be hard pressed to find another one that provides the same ease of installation/removal and optimized ground clearance and U-joint operational angles. You can chop up the stock Chevelle crossmember, space it up off the frame rails and rework the center pad to provide similar geometry, but it will be a pain in the *** to install it unless you also modify one of its ends to be removable. The Hooker crossmember won't be available for another 45 days, but I'll be featuring more photos and CAD images of it on this thread next week so those interested in it can get a look at the benefits it will provide to the user.

Originally Posted by the450r
Any update on the exhaust systems? Materials being used and styles?
These new Hooker A-body swap components/systems are part of the Blackheart line, so they will only be offered in stainless steel (304SS). The tailpipes of the systems exit as turn-downs under the rear bumper valence.
